Nice summary page. But how could they omit a link to Heroic Launcher? I still haven't figured out how to set up Bottles, but running games from GOG or Epic is a breeze with Heroic. Cloud saves even mostly work (in my very limited testing) which is pretty much essential if gaming on both a regular PC and Steam Deck.

KDE is an international technology team creating user-friendly free and open source software for desktop and portable computing. KDE's software runs on GNU/Linux, BSD and other operating systems, including Windows.
